        Answer : Option 2) -168

        Explanation :
        => (fg)(−2) = f(−2)×g(−2).
        => f(−2) = 8−10(−2) = 8+20 = 28
        => g(−2) = 5(−2)+4 = −10+4 = −6

        Then, (fg)(−2) = 28×−6 = −168
